Mixed farming and agroforestry systems: A systematic review on value chain implications

Guy Low, Tobias Dalhaus and Miranda P.M. Meuwissen

Agricultural Systems, 2023, vol. 206, issue C

Abstract: Mixed farming and agroforestry systems (MiFAS) are widely proposed to deal with ecological, economic, and social challenges that are associated with specialised farming systems. However, little is known about how MiFAS are integrated in food value chains and how value creation in MiFAS is rewarded by value chain actors.
